Output 60e24b4cd0b44ae1608827da2f65d83f5d795ec5b030d5a519ee80d442e4ec13:1

value
17982658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 033ab31970002abb4f2ba10d872968856d5d9ea2 OP_EQUALVERIFY OP_CHECKSIG
address
1J5M6YsF2bmRV7CSYiLFNBcoRVY2XN8iJ
transaction
60e24b4cd0b44ae1608827da2f65d83f5d795ec5b030d5a519ee80d442e4ec13
confirmations
380686
spent
true